Answer:

[tex]x=\sqrt{33}[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

We can use the Pythagorean theorem to solve this

in the 11, 13 triangle,

[tex]11^2 + h^2 = 13^2\\121 + h^2 = 169\\h^2 = 48\\h = 4\sqrt{3}[/tex]

to find x

[tex]x^2 + (4\sqrt{3} )^2=9^2\\x^2 + 48 = 81\\x^2 = 33\\x = \sqrt{33}[/tex]
